Henry de Monfreid (14 November 1879 in Leucate - 13 December 1974) was a French adventurer and author. Born in Leucate, Aude, France, he was the son of artist painter Georges-Daniel de Monfreid and knew Paul Gauguin as a child.

"Henry de Monfreid was a nobleman, writer, smuggler and adventurer who travelled the world during the 1920s with his wife and young daughter in search of excitement and quick money. First seeking his fortune by becoming a collector and merchant of the fabled Gulf pearls, he was then drawn into the shadowy world of arms trading, slavery and drugs.

Henry de Monfreid began his career in the Horn of Africa in 1910, working for the Djibouti firm, Guignony, as a trader in Abyssinian hides and coffee. Henry de Monfreid, né le 14 novembre 1879 à La Franqui, commune de Leucate ( Aude ), et mort le 13 décembre 1974 à Ingrandes ( Indre ), est un commerçant et écrivain français.

Born in 1879 in Southwest France, Henry de Monfreid lived the first part of his childhood on the Mediterranean seashore in a resort hotel owned by his maternal grandparents.
